The policy of the
State Government is to ensure that State Government
departments and agencies under the control of the
State Government purchase their requirements of store
items from industries located inside the State. In
order to achieve this, the products of industries
located inside the State will be eligible for the
facility of preferential purchase by State Government
departments and agencies under its control. Central
Government agencies and private/joint sector industries
located inside the State will be persuaded to accord
similar facilities to products of local industries.
Simultaneously, efforts will be made to bring down
cost and achieve over all competitiveness of the products
of local industries. New industrial units coming up
in the State will be persuaded to patronize local
industries/firms for construction/supply of materials.
The
following additional incentives will be available to
new Electronics/Telecommunication (Hardware and Software)
industrial units :-
Land at Bhubaneshwar
(including Chandaka Industrial Area) will be allotted
@ Rs.5 lakh per acre.
Electronics/Telecommunication
(Hardware and Software) industrial units will be
eligible for incentives applicable to Zone-A irrespective
of their actual location.
In appropriate cases, venture
capital for technical entrepreneurs (belonging to Electronics
and Computer disciplines) up to 50% of the equity requirements,
subject to a limit of Rs. 25 lakhs (either singly or
jointly) and equity participation for other categories
of entrepreneurs up to 25%, subject to a limit of Rs.
25 lakhs will be provided. This facility will be available
for a maximum period of five years with effect from
the effective date.
Travel assistance to technical
entrepreneurs (belonging to Electronics and Computer
disciplines) to go abroad for interaction with software
industries and organisations likely to offer
software assignments. This assistance can only be availed
of by those sponsored by the Department of Science and
Technology.
Development of the Film Industry
will be supported in such manner and to such extent
as the Orissa Film Development Corporation (OFDC) may
decide with the approval of the Government. New cinema
halls mean cinema halls for which investment in land,
building and equipment has been made on or after the
effective date.
Incentives for new cinema halls
will be available to cinema halls in areas other than
urban areas having a population of 1 lakh or more according
to the 1991 census and subject to other conditions,
if any, mentioned against each incentive.

New industrial units with contract
demand up to 500 KVA will be exempted from payment of
electricity duty for a period of 5 years from the date
of power supply.
New industrial units with contract
demand between 500 KVA and 5000 KVA will be exempted
from payment of 50 per cent of electricity duty for
a period of 5 years from the date of power supply if
they are located in Zone-A. For new industrial units
located in Zone- B and C, this exemption shall be respectively
35 per cent and 25 per cent for 5 years.
New industrial
units with contract demand between 5,000 KVA and 10,000
KVA will be exempted from payment of 25 per cent of
electricity duty payable or a period of 5 years from
the date of power supply if these are set up in Zone-A,
15 per cent in Zone- B
and 10 per cent in Zone-C.
